United States the world's first approached the problemmost rare diseases scale. In 1982, America was organized by a special unit, which officially under state control was engaged in the development and clinical trials of drugs and biologicals that could help patients with such diseases. Moreover, in 1983 the US government passed a law regulating the status rare patients and claimed their privileges. Example proved to be productive, and over the next ten years, many countries, including Japan, Singapore, Australia, South Korea, Canada and Taiwan have adopted similar laws, which are much easier life for people with unusual diseases.

 Elephantiasis (elephantiasis)

The disease is caused by parasitic worms that are transmitted by the bite of mosquitoes. They settled in the lymph nodes and prevent human normal flow of lymph. As a result, diseased organs swell to enormous size, usually the disease affects the legs.

 Progeria

Premature aging of the body, which leads to early death. All internal and external changes do not correspond to the calendar age of onset, 7-8-year-old child looks like a 80-year-old man.
